How much does pest extermination cost?

Average cost for Pest Control ranges from. $250 - $400 The average cost for pest control is $250. Hiring a exterminator to control pests, you will likely spend between $250 and $400. The price of pest control can vary greatly by region (and even by zip code).

Also, how much does quarterly pest control cost? Most pest control companies either recommend or require regular maintenance visits, which can be $25-$60 for monthly applications or $30-$110 for quarterly service, making a total annual cost of $300-$600 or more.

What is the difference between pest control and exterminator?

Exterminators rely on pesticides to eliminate the unwanted pests, using chemicals that could be more toxic than necessary whereas a pest control professional will focus on why the pests are present and look to alter the conditions that attracted them in the first place.

What spray do pest control companies use?

Permethrin is the most common active ingredient in insecticides applied by licensed exterminators. It is one of a large class of chemical insecticides known as pyrethroids. They mimic pyrethrins, which are botanical insecticides typically derived from Australian and African chrysanthemum flower varieties.

How often should I do pest control?

How Often Should You Use Pest Prevention Services? Most professionals recommend coming out and treating your home and lawn every other month for the purpose of pest prevention. The reason for this is the average treatment from your pest prevention service lasts for about two months.

How long do pesticides last in house?

Each pesticide can have many half-lives depending on conditions in the environment. For example, permethrin breaks down at different speeds in soil, in water, on plants, and in homes. In soil, the half-life of permethrin is about 40 days, ranging from 11-113 days.

How often should you spray house for bugs?

DIY Insect Prevention Treatment We recommend applying a liquid insecticide around the perimeter of your home or structure at least once every 90 days. If you know you have high pest populations on your property, or you live in an area with seasons of intense heat, we recommend spraying once per month.

Do I need to leave the house for pest control?

Modern pest control sprays are safe to use for both indoors and outdoors, so there is no reason to leave your home. However, the technicians will ask you to wait for about 15 minutes to let the treatment dry. It dries quickly and does not cause any serious issues or leave a residue.
